Understanding Sash WindowsWhat Are Sash Windows?
Sash windows are vertically sliding windows normally constructed of multiple glass panes bordered by wood frames, referred to as sashes. They were promoted in the 17th century and ended up being a staple in Georgian and Victorian architecture.

Key Characteristics:
Dual Sashed Design: They include 2 sashes, with the upper one sliding down and the lower one moving up.Standard Materials: Originally made from wood, [Sash Window Refitting Experts](https://pad.karuka.tech/Ycs4bIn3RyqNUMq28IcAZg/) windows frequently include elaborate moldings and glazing bars.Traditional Aesthetics: They contribute to the historic and architectural significance of many British homes.Significance of Sash Windows
Sash windows enhance the visual appeal of a home, enabling natural light to light up interiors while permitting a gentle breeze. Moreover, their historic significance contributes to the architectural heritage of the UK.
The Restoration Process
Bring back sash windows is a diverse procedure that needs skill, perseverance, and an extensive understanding of conventional strategies. Here's a detailed breakdown of what's included:
1. Initial Inspection
Specialists start with a comprehensive examination to assess the condition of the windows. This consists of monitoring for:
Rotting or damaged woodInadequate glazingFaulty hardware systems2. Removal
If required, sash windows may be thoroughly gotten rid of to assist in the restoration process without harming the surrounding architecture.
3. Repair and Refurbishment
This phase includes:
Replacing rotten or damaged wood: Sections that are beyond repair need to be changed.Removing and repainting: Removing old paint and applying new layers, frequently using breathable paints to prevent moisture build-up.Glazing: Repairing or changing glass panes, ensuring energy effectiveness and aesthetic appeals.4. Reinstallation
After repairs, the windows are reinstalled with care, making sure smooth operation as soon as again. Specialists make sure that the balance weights and wheels operate correctly for easy moving.
5. Ending up Touches
The restoration procedure concludes with the application of water-repellent treatments, making sure lasting defense against the components.

Frequently asked question Section1. For how long does sash window restoration take?
The time needed for restoration can differ significantly based on the degree of work needed. Small repairs can take a few days, while comprehensive restoration might encompass a number of weeks.
2. Can I try to restore sash windows myself?
While small maintenance tasks like painting are feasible for some house owners, extensive restoration is finest delegated specialists. Incorrect strategies can lead to further damage.
3. What are the typical expenses associated with sash window restoration?
Expenses can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 600 per window, depending on aspects such as the extent of damage and products used. Special jobs, like bespoke sashes, might cost considerably more.
4. How can I maintain my restored sash windows?
Regular maintenance can lengthen the life expectancy of brought back sash windows. This includes annual inspections, repainting when essential, and guaranteeing that the hardware remains practical.
